Eligibility Criteria
A-He/she shall complete the age of 17 years on or before 31st December, of the year of admission to the MBBS course;
B-He/she has passed a qualifying examination as under
The higher secondary examination or the Indian School Certificate Examination which is equivalent to 10+2 Higher Secondary Examination after 12 years of study, the last two years of study comprising of Physics, Chemistry, Biology, and Mathematics or any other elective subjects with English at a level not less than the core course for English as prescribed by the National Council for Educational Research and Training after the introduction of the 10+2+3 years educational structure as recommended by the National Committee on education;
or
The intermediate examination in science of an Indian University/Board or other recognized examining body with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ology which shall include a practical test in these subjects and also English as a compulsory subject;
or
The pre-professional/pre-medical examination with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ology, after passing either the higher secondary school examination, pre-university, or an equivalent examination. The pre-professional/pre-medical examination shall include a practical test in Physics, Chemistry,y and Biology and also English as a compulsory subject;
or
The first year of the three-year degree course at a recognized university, with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ology including a practical test in three subjects provided the examination is a "University Examination" and the candidate has passed 10+2 with English at a level not less than a core course;
or
B.Sc examination of an Indian University provided that he/she has passed the B.Sc examination with not less than two of the following subjects Physics, Chemistry, Biology (Botany, Zoology) and further that he/she has passed the earlier qualifying examination with the following subjects-Physics, Chemistry, Biology and English.
